Output 55ad88dcd3986d940399e796b9b6070a3c8cb24cd7a883fd37285b55a0c216bf:6

value
30359966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e42c7cf81df8e0623a80eb7d2f15da7f0fd185d7 OP_EQUAL
address
MUhdbFyzcK9npzquf3WEHLK966QkBXwsYb
transaction
55ad88dcd3986d940399e796b9b6070a3c8cb24cd7a883fd37285b55a0c216bf
spent
true